What is the ruling on objects found in the Two Holy Sanctuaries (Haramain) and how should they be dealt with?
Lost items in Mecca are of two types: 1. Those of no value: The finder may take them without making an announcement. 2. Those of value: These must always be announced, and it is not permissible to claim ownership of them, due to the Prophet's (peace and blessings be upon him) saying: "And its lost item is not permissible except for one who announces it."
As for lost items in Medina: The majority of scholars hold that they are like lost items in other cities; they are announced for a year, and then it becomes permissible to claim ownership.
When a valuable lost item is found in the Two Holy Sanctuaries (Mecca and Medina): It must be handed over to the relevant authorities responsible for lost and found items, so that they may undertake its announcement.
